Functional Beer And Candy Brews To Trend In 2025

The beverage industry is constantly evolving, with consumers increasingly seeking drinks that offer both pleasure and health benefits. This shift has paved the way for the rise of "functional beverages"—drinks infused with vitamins, minerals, adaptogens, or other beneficial ingredients. Looking ahead to 2025, two particularly interesting trends are emerging: functional beer and candy-flavored brews.

Functional Beer: Beyond the Buzz

For years, beer has been primarily associated with its alcoholic content and its social aspect. However, a growing segment of consumers is seeking alcoholic beverages that also offer health-conscious benefits. This has spurred innovation in the brewing industry, leading to the creation of functional beers.

What Makes a Beer "Functional"?

Functional beers aren't simply about adding vitamins to existing brews. The focus is on incorporating ingredients that deliver specific benefits, such as:

  • Improved gut health: The inclusion of probiotics or prebiotics can aid digestion and boost gut microbiome diversity.
  • Reduced inflammation: Certain ingredients, like turmeric or ginger, have anti-inflammatory properties.
  • Enhanced sleep: The incorporation of calming ingredients like chamomile or melatonin (within legal limits) could promote better sleep quality.
  • Increased energy: Certain adaptogens or natural stimulants might provide a more sustainable energy boost.

Challenges and Opportunities

While the potential of functional beer is substantial, brewers face several challenges:

  • Balancing taste and function: The addition of functional ingredients can impact the taste and aroma of the beer. Maintaining a desirable flavor profile while delivering health benefits requires skillful formulation.
  • Regulatory hurdles: Navigating the complexities of food and beverage regulations is essential, particularly concerning the labeling and claims related to health benefits.
  • Consumer perception: Educating consumers about the benefits of functional beer and dispelling misconceptions about "health drinks" will be key to market success.

Candy-Flavored Brews: A Sweet Escape

Another notable trend is the surge in popularity of candy-flavored beers. These brews aim to capture the nostalgic appeal of classic candies, translating familiar sweet and tart flavors into alcoholic beverages.

Beyond Gummy Bears: Flavor Innovation

This trend isn't limited to simple fruit flavors. Brewers are experimenting with a wide range of candy-inspired profiles, including:

  • Chocolate and caramel: Rich and decadent flavors that appeal to a broad audience.
  • Sour candies: The tartness of sour candies adds a unique twist to the usual beer profile.
  • Hard candies: The crispness and intense flavors of hard candies provide a distinctive sensory experience.

The Appeal of Nostalgia

The success of candy-flavored beers lies in their ability to tap into consumer nostalgia. These brews offer a playful and indulgent experience, evoking childhood memories and creating a sense of fun and enjoyment.

The Future of Functional and Candy-Flavored Brews

The combination of functional benefits and appealing flavors positions both trends for significant growth in 2025 and beyond. However, continued innovation, careful formulation, and effective marketing will be crucial for brewers to capture the attention of health-conscious and adventurous consumers. The success of these brews hinges on their ability to deliver both enjoyable taste and tangible benefits, offering a unique experience that resonates with a broad audience.
